SUMMARY:

Samsung is seeking to hire Jr. Level to Sr. Level Controls Engineer for our 1st, 2nd and 3rd Shift operations, The Controls Engineer will be responsible to help maintain and support the manufacturing line. This includes responding to breakdown maintenance calls for troubleshooting, modifying and building corresponding ladder logic within the PLC to recover assembly line operation. The Controls Engineer works closely with cross-functional teams, including process engineers, production operators, and quality control specialists to create and improve production methods.
